- Manager Danny Röhl told Sky Sports that Connor Barron faces eight to 12 weeks out with a knee injury sustained late in the 2-0 win at Aberdeen.
- Dujon Sterling has a hamstring problem and will miss the weekend, with Röhl saying he could be available for Dundee later in January.
- Barron’s absence removes a recent standout who set up both goals against Aberdeen and had become central to Röhl’s midfield.
- The layoff is set to span a busy run of Premiership, Europa League and Scottish Cup fixtures across the next two months.
- Röhl said Oliver Antman and Joe Rothwell are back in training but not ready to start, with James Tavernier expected to cover at right-back in Sterling’s absence.
